logo
Bali

21 day itinerary for Bali

Personalized with:

Make it with attractive activities

Share and earn 3 free tokens

They get 5 tokens for signing up with your link

Itinerary

Bali is a stunning destination with a rich culture, beautiful landscapes, and plenty of activities to keep you entertained. Here’s a fun and engaging 21-day itinerary that balances relaxation, adventure, and cultural experiences. Let’s dive in!

## Day 1: Arrival in Bali

  • Morning: Arrive at Ngurah Rai International Airport. Check into your hotel in Seminyak.
  • Afternoon: Relax at Seminyak Beach. Enjoy a beachside lunch at a local café.
  • Evening: Stroll through the vibrant streets of Seminyak, shop for souvenirs, and have dinner at a trendy restaurant.

## Day 2: Explore Seminyak

  • Morning: Take a yoga class at a local studio.
  • Afternoon: Visit the Petitenget Temple and enjoy a beach day.
  • Evening: Watch the sunset at La Plancha, a colorful beach bar.

## Day 3: Ubud Bound

## Day 4: Culture and Art in Ubud

## Day 5: Adventure Day

  • Morning: Go white-water rafting on the Ayung River.
  • Afternoon: Relax at your hotel or visit a spa for a traditional Balinese massage.
  • Evening: Dinner at a restaurant with a view of the rice fields.

## Day 6: Mount Batur Sunrise Trek

  • Early Morning: Depart for a sunrise trek up Mount Batur. Enjoy breakfast with a view.
  • Afternoon: Visit a coffee plantation on your way back.
  • Evening: Relax and recover at your hotel.

## Day 7: Northern Bali Exploration

  • Morning: Head to Lovina Beach. Enjoy dolphin watching at sunrise.
  • Afternoon: Visit the Gitgit Waterfall and take a refreshing dip.
  • Evening: Dinner at a beachfront restaurant in Lovina.

## Day 8: Cultural Sites

## Day 9: Relaxation Day

  • Morning: Enjoy a leisurely breakfast and relax at your hotel.
  • Afternoon: Visit a local art gallery or take a pottery class.
  • Evening: Dinner at a rooftop restaurant in Ubud.

## Day 10: Head to Nusa Penida

  • Morning: Take a fast boat to Nusa Penida.
  • Afternoon: Visit Kelingking Beach and enjoy the stunning views.
  • Evening: Check into your accommodation and have dinner at a local warung.

## Day 11: Nusa Penida Adventure

## Day 12: Return to Bali

  • Morning: Take the boat back to Bali and head to Canggu.
  • Afternoon: Explore the trendy cafes and shops in Canggu.
  • Evening: Dinner at a beach club with live music.

## Day 13: Surfing and Relaxation

  • Morning: Take a surfing lesson at Echo Beach.
  • Afternoon: Relax at the beach or visit a local spa.
  • Evening: Enjoy sunset at Tanah Lot Temple.

## Day 14: Day Trip to Uluwatu

## Day 15: Beach Day

  • Morning: Spend the day at Bingin Beach.
  • Afternoon: Enjoy lunch at a beachside café.
  • Evening: Dinner at a seafood restaurant in Jimbaran.

## Day 16: Water Sports Day

  • Morning: Head to Tanjung Benoa for water sports (jet skiing, parasailing).
  • Afternoon: Relax at the beach or visit a local market.
  • Evening: Dinner at a beachfront restaurant.

## Day 17: Explore East Bali

## Day 18: Relaxation and Spa Day

  • Morning: Enjoy a leisurely breakfast and relax at your hotel.
  • Afternoon: Treat yourself to a spa day with massages and treatments.
  • Evening: Dinner at a fine dining restaurant.

## Day 19: Shopping and Culture

## Day 20: Last Day in Bali

  • Morning: Enjoy a leisurely breakfast and do some last-minute shopping.
  • Afternoon: Visit a local art market for souvenirs.
  • Evening: Farewell dinner at a restaurant with a view of the sunset.

## Day 21: Departure

  • Morning: Relax at your hotel or take a final stroll on the beach.
  • Afternoon: Check out and head to the airport for your departure.

This itinerary offers a mix of adventure, relaxation, and cultural experiences, ensuring you get the most out of your 21 days in Bali. Enjoy your trip, and don’t forget to take lots of pictures! 🌴✨

Places of interest

Ngurah Rai International Airport Bali

Ngurah Rai International Airport

Loading more info...

Seminyak Beach Bali

Seminyak Beach

Loading more info...

Petitenget Temple Bali

Petitenget Temple

Loading more info...

La Plancha Bali

La Plancha

Loading more info...

Tegalalang Rice Terraces Bali

Tegalalang Rice Terraces

Loading more info...

Ubud Monkey Forest Bali

Ubud Monkey Forest

Loading more info...

Ubud Market Bali

Ubud Market

Loading more info...

Agung Rai Museum of Art (ARMA) Bali

Agung Rai Museum of Art (ARMA)

Loading more info...

Ubud Palace Bali

Ubud Palace

Loading more info...

Ayung River Bali

Ayung River

Loading more info...

Mount Batur Bali

Mount Batur

Loading more info...

Coffee plantation Bali

Coffee plantation

Loading more info...

Lovina Beach Bali

Lovina Beach

Loading more info...

Gitgit Waterfall Bali

Gitgit Waterfall

Loading more info...

Ulun Danu Beratan Temple Bali

Ulun Danu Beratan Temple

Loading more info...

Jatiluwih Rice Terraces Bali

Jatiluwih Rice Terraces

Loading more info...

Nusa Penida Bali

Nusa Penida

Loading more info...

Kelingking Beach Bali

Kelingking Beach

Loading more info...

Crystal Bay Bali

Crystal Bay

Loading more info...

Angel’s Billabong Bali

Angel’s Billabong

Loading more info...

Broken Beach Bali

Broken Beach

Loading more info...

Canggu Bali

Canggu

Loading more info...

Echo Beach Bali

Echo Beach

Loading more info...

Tanah Lot Temple Bali

Tanah Lot Temple

Loading more info...

Uluwatu Temple Bali

Uluwatu Temple

Loading more info...

Padang Padang Beach Bali

Padang Padang Beach

Loading more info...

Bingin Beach Bali

Bingin Beach

Loading more info...

Jimbaran Bali

Jimbaran

Loading more info...

Tanjung Benoa Bali

Tanjung Benoa

Loading more info...

Tirta Gangga Water Palace Bali

Tirta Gangga Water Palace

Loading more info...

Tenganan Bali

Tenganan

Loading more info...

Bali Collection Bali

Bali Collection

Loading more info...

Museum Pasifika Bali

Museum Pasifika

Loading more info...

Local art market Bali

Local art market

Loading more info...

Recent searches
© 2023 Roam Around. All Rights Reserved.